Psalm 131

1 Jehovah, my heart is not haughty, nor mine eyes lofty;
Neither do I exercise myself in great matters,
Or in things too wonderful for me.

General Subject. Of the Lord. P. P.
1 See Psalm xviii. 1. R. 279.
See Psalm xviii. 1. E. 326.

2 Surely I have stilled and quieted my soul;
Like a weaned child with his mother,
Like a weaned child is my soul within me.

1, 2. He operated from His Human: He indeed operated through influx from the Divine, but not from the Divine alone. P. P.

3 O Israel, hope in Jehovah
From this time forth and for evermore.

3 Let the trust of the church be in Him. P. P.
